Theatre and Communication Arts Major

(52-55 hours, including supporting course set) - Isaacson, Coordinator
*Alternate year course      NOTE: Students must have a grade of "C" or higher in all 
                                                    courses listed below, and in the required courses 

Core Courses:                                                                                       Hrs.
CM101                        Human Communication

3

CM110 Speaking and Listening

3

TH110* Introduction to Theatre

3

TH111 Acting

3

CM190 Communication Activities

1-4

CM205 Mass Media and Modern Society

3

CM212 Oral Interpretation

3

EN301               Writing, Language and Rhetoric             

3

CM/TH310 Performance and Dramatic Theory

3

CM391 Senior Project

3

Total (28-31)
